Overview
This specialization is designed for post-graduate students aiming to advance their skills in AI, cybersecurity, & industrial control systems (ICS) security. Through three in-depth courses, you will explore AI safety, trust, security, privacy, and critical topics like AI governance, policy frameworks, and the impact of large language models (LLMs) such as ChatGPT. Also, you will gain a comprehensive understanding of (ICSs), including their architecture, security risks, and best practices for risk assessment and incident response. You will be equipped to address cybersecurity challenges within both AI and operational technology (OT) systems, secure industrial control networks, and manage the convergence of AI and cybersecurity in modern infrastructures. This program prepares you to navigate the evolving landscape of AI and ICS security, positioning you for roles that require expertise in securing both AI technologies and industrial networks. The specialization also covers malware, anti-virus, vulnerability principles, Internet of Things (IoT), Mobile Application Security, Border Gateway Protocols (BGP), anonymization, ICS, DNS Resource Record Types, and analyzing DNS, HTTP, SMTP, and TCP protocols. Tools include SiLK, NetFlow, Wireshark, IPTables, Splunk, Node-Red IoT framework, virtual machines, and TCPDump. Further exploration will include vulnerabilities and countermeasures for IT & OT protocols like WNAN, ZigBee, EMV, SIGFOX, CIP, MODBUS, DNP3, OPC, HART, BACnet, & ICCP.
Syllabus
Course 1: Cybersecurity Fundamentals
- Offered by Johns Hopkins University. The course "Cybersecurity Fundamentals" provides a robust foundation in cybersecurity essentials, ... Enroll for free.
Course 2: Advanced Network Security and Analysis
- Offered by Johns Hopkins University. The course "Advanced Network Security and Analysis" dives into the essential skills needed to protect ... Enroll for free.
Course 3: Artificial Intelligence Industrial Control Systems Security
- Offered by Johns Hopkins University. The course "Artificial Intelligence Industrial Control Systems Security" explores the intersection of ... Enroll for free.
- Offered by Johns Hopkins University. The course "Cybersecurity Fundamentals" provides a robust foundation in cybersecurity essentials, ... Enroll for free.
Course 2: Advanced Network Security and Analysis
- Offered by Johns Hopkins University. The course "Advanced Network Security and Analysis" dives into the essential skills needed to protect ... Enroll for free.
Course 3: Artificial Intelligence Industrial Control Systems Security
- Offered by Johns Hopkins University. The course "Artificial Intelligence Industrial Control Systems Security" explores the intersection of ... Enroll for free.
Courses
-
The course "Advanced Network Security and Analysis" dives into the essential skills needed to protect and analyze complex network environments. This course covers advanced topics like anonymization techniques, mobile application security, and in-depth analysis of DNS, HTTP, SMTP, and TCP protocols. Learners will gain practical experience in recognizing vulnerabilities and analyzing network traffic to detect potential threats. Each module offers hands-on insights into industry-standard tools and techniques, equipping students to address real-world security challenges confidently. Uniquely focused on practical application, the course empowers students to work with tools like Splunk, TCPDump, and Wireshark, ensuring they can navigate and mitigate complex network security scenarios. Through interactive content, learners will gain a comprehensive understanding of network protocols, explore the mechanics of cyber-attacks, and learn how to implement effective defenses. By the end of the course, students will have developed an advanced toolkit for safeguarding modern network infrastructures, making them valuable assets in any IT security environment.
-
The course "Artificial Intelligence Industrial Control Systems Security" explores the intersection of artificial intelligence (AI) and industrial control systems (ICS) security, focusing on the safety, trust, and privacy of AI technologies within critical infrastructures. Learners will gain a comprehensive understanding of the key cybersecurity challenges faced by ICS and the role AI can play in mitigating these risks. Through the exploration of large language models (LLMs), regulatory frameworks, and advanced ICS protocols, students will learn how to implement robust security measures for AI systems and industrial control environments. The course stands out by providing hands-on learning experiences in critical areas such as supply chain risks, cybersecurity for PLCs, and OT protocols. By combining AI principles with real-world ICS security practices, learners will be equipped to analyze and respond to emerging threats in both AI and ICS sectors. This unique approach ensures a deeper, more integrated understanding of how AI can be applied to enhance cybersecurity in industrial environments. Whether you're a professional or a beginner, this course will prepare you to tackle the most pressing security challenges at the intersection of AI and industrial control systems.
-
The course "Cybersecurity Fundamentals" provides a robust foundation in cybersecurity essentials, preparing you to recognize and manage threats in today's digital landscape. Across four comprehensive modules, you'll gain hands-on experience with malware identification, network traffic analysis, internet addressing, and IoT security protocols. In Module 1, explore the relationship between faults, vulnerabilities, and exploits, and learn essential malware identification techniques. Module 2 introduces NetFlow analysis with tools like SiLK and Wireshark, equipping you to collect and interpret network data. Module 3 deepens your understanding of IPv4 and IPv6, BGP routing, and host lookup tools, while Module 4 addresses IoT cybersecurity, where you’ll build a secure IoT framework using Docker and Node-Red. This course stands out by combining practical exercises with foundational knowledge, ensuring you’re ready to apply what you learn to real-world situations. Whether you’re a beginner or expanding your cybersecurity expertise, completing this course will enhance your ability to protect networks, manage internet space, and secure IoT devices—skills in high demand across the IT sector.
Taught by
Jason Crossland